The University of Notre Dame has opened its graduate application process for 2027, offering fellowship opportunities for outstanding PhD students. The Arthur J. Schmitt Presidential Leadership Fellowship supports graduate students in science and engineering.
The fellowship covers full tuition and provides an annual living allowance. Selected students also receive full coverage of the university’s student health insurance premium.
Applicants do not submit a separate fellowship application. Instead, they apply for admission to an eligible graduate program, after which departments nominate candidates for competitive fellowship consideration.
Arthur J. Schmitt Fellowship Benefits
The fellowship can provide financial support for up to five years. Students must maintain satisfactory academic progress toward their degrees to continue receiving funding.
The benefits include:
- Full tuition coverage
- Annual stipend
- 12-month stipend support each year
- Full premium coverage for the university’s student health insurance plan
- Funding for up to five years, subject to academic progress
Notre Dame’s benefits information lists an annual stipend of $45,540. However, the same university page reportedly gives an overview figure of $44,000.
Applicants should confirm the stipend amount applicable to their 2027 fellowship with Notre Dame before relying on either figure.
The fellowship receives support from the Arthur J. Schmitt Foundation. The foundation has supported graduate education and research in science and engineering at Notre Dame for more than four decades.
Who Can Apply?
The fellowship is intended for outstanding graduate students pursuing eligible programs in science and engineering. Applicants must first gain admission to a qualifying full-time graduate program at Notre Dame.
Notre Dame’s general graduate admission requirements include a bachelor’s degree or equivalent qualification. Applicants generally need an undergraduate GPA of at least 3.0 on a 4.0 scale.
However, individual departments may set higher academic standards. They can also require additional qualifications, tests or application materials.
International students can apply if they satisfy the admission requirements of their selected program.
English Language Requirements
Applicants who need to demonstrate English proficiency can submit an accepted language test. Notre Dame lists IELTS, TOEFL and Duolingo English Test scores among its accepted options.
The listed minimum scores include:
- IELTS: 7.0 overall
- Duolingo English Test: 120 overall
- TOEFL iBT: 80 overall under the older 120-point scale, including at least 23 in Speaking
- Updated TOEFL iBT: 4.5 average under the 1–6 scale, with no section below 4.0
Applicants should check their department’s requirements because English language conditions can vary by program.
Application Deadline
The stated application deadline for consideration is December 1, 2026. Notre Dame considers eligible students through its graduate admission process rather than using a separate Schmitt Fellowship application.
However, individual departments can establish their own admission deadlines. Students should therefore verify the deadline for their chosen 2027 PhD program before submitting their application.
Documents Required
Applicants should prepare the documents required by their selected graduate program. These commonly include:
- Academic transcripts from all colleges or universities attended
- CV or résumé
- Statement of intent outlining academic interests and research plans
- Three letters of recommendation
- English proficiency test scores, if required
- GRE scores or other documents, if required by the department
Additional materials may be required depending on the chosen program.
How to Apply for the Schmitt Fellowship
First, applicants should select an eligible science or engineering PhD program at Notre Dame. They should review the program’s admission requirements, research areas and application deadline.
Next, applicants should access Notre Dame’s graduate admissions portal and select the 2027 application. They can then create an account, complete the application and upload the required documents.
Applicants must also provide contact information for three referees. They should give recommenders sufficient time to submit their letters before the relevant departmental deadline.
Eligible admitted full-time graduate students are automatically considered for Notre Dame’s select fellowship opportunities. Departments nominate candidates, followed by a competitive university-level selection process.
Application Fee and Fee Waiver
Notre Dame charges a $75 application fee for graduate applications. Students experiencing financial hardship may request a fee waiver through the application system.
Some departments may also provide application fee waivers. Applicants should follow the instructions provided in the application form and submit any supporting information requested.
